What is the Contact Form?
The MYZO Contact Form allows visitors to send you messages directly from your profile page. Instead of displaying your email address publicly, visitors complete a form and their messages arrive in your private dashboard inbox. This guide explains how the contact form works, what information it collects, and how to get started.

How the Contact Form Works
The contact form process involves five simple steps:
The Contact Form Flow
- You enable the form: Turn on the contact form in your profile settings
- Button appears: A Contact or Message button displays on your public profile
- Visitor fills form: They enter their name, email, and message
- Message delivered: The submission arrives in your Dashboard Inbox
- You respond: Read the message and reply via email
This flow captures visitor information and gives you control over when and how you respond.
Information Collected by the Form
The contact form gathers the following information from visitors:
| Field | Required | Purpose |
|---|---|---|
| Name | Yes | Identify who is contacting you |
| Yes | Allow you to respond to them | |
| Phone | No | Optional contact method |
| Subject | No | Brief topic description |
| Message | Yes | The actual content of their inquiry |
Visitors must provide their email address so you have a way to respond to their message.
Plan Requirements
The Contact Form and Inbox features are available exclusively to Pro and Business subscribers.
| Plan | Contact Form Access |
|---|---|
| Free | Not available |
| Pro | Full access |
| Business | Full access |
Free plan users can still display their email address as a clickable contact link. The contact form with inbox management requires a paid subscription.
Getting Started with Contact Forms
Follow these steps to enable the contact form on your profile:
- Go to your Dashboard
- Navigate to Settings or Profile settings
- Find the Enable Contact Form option
- Turn the toggle ON
- Save your changes
Once enabled, a Contact button appears on your public profile. Test it by viewing your public profile and clicking the button.
Where Messages Appear
All contact form submissions arrive in your Dashboard Inbox:
- Go to your Dashboard
- Click on Inbox in the navigation
- New messages appear with unread indicators
- Click any message to read the full content
Check your inbox regularly to respond to visitor inquiries promptly.
